I need some help with teh weapon_event
I need to find when a player shoots their weapon and shoots a player (successfully and unsuccessfully)

I guess there would both use weapon_event, but im not sure how to register_event("CurWeapon", "..........) properly for each

The best way i think that it is with fakemeta ->

PHP Code:
public plugin_init()
{
    
register_forward(FM_TraceLine"fw_traceline")
}

public 
fw_traceline(Float:start[3], Float:end[3], conditionsidtr)
{
    if (!
is_user_alive(id)) return FMRES_IGNORED
    
new target get_tr2(trTR_pHit)
    
    if (!
is_user_alive(target))
        
client_print(0,print_chat,"MISSED LOSER!!! :P")
    else
        
client_print(0,print_chat,"GOOD SHOT!!!")

    return 
FMRES_IGNORED
